Until October 2018, my principal job was that of Chief Executive of pro.manchester. I was appointed as CEO of pro-manchester in October 2009. I enjoyed nine years in the role. During that time, I worked with a close team of senior managers, to transform pro-manchester from a loss making, members organization, dependent on public sector funding, into a profitable, professional B2B company, private sector funded, with an outstanding reputation for events, marketing and business development.
I have been involved in business in some way or other for over forty years. I have extensive executive & non executive director experience of SME and large businesses in the UK and internationally. I have worked in family owned, institutionally owned, private and public companies. I have worked in corporate finance and corporate development, creating models and profiles for acquisition targets.
I have led on over 50 corporate finance transactions including a $1 billion US deal in 1987. I have worked with First Boston, Bain & Co, Samuel Montagu, Goldman Sachs and many more. In the 1980's we developed the Coloroll Group from a small family owned business to an international public company. Revenues increased from £6 million to over £600 million in twelve years,
I have experience of public and private sectors, I have served on the Board of Marketing Manchester, the AGMA Business Leadership Council, the Council of Manchester Business School, the Board of Inward, the President's Council of Business in the Community and the President's Council of the CBI.
I was founding Chairman of the North West Business Leadership Team, a Granada Telethon Trustee and a School Governor. I was Chief Economist GM Chamber of Commerce 2013 - 2015.
I have extensive experience of working in complex board room environments demanding a high degree of corporate governance. I am a Fellow of the Royal Society of Arts, a Companion of The British Institute of Management and a member of the Society of Business Economists. I have a PhD in economics.
